Medicaid keeps getting more popular as Republicans aim to cut it by $800 billion

Medicaid's popularity has surged recently, with 83% of the public viewing it favorably, including 75% of Republicans.

Who would govern Sweden if an election were held today?

According to Statistics Sweden's survey, the Social Democrats would get 36.2 percent of the vote, a significant increase ahead of the next election.
